Chk1 and Wee1 kinases coordinate DNA replication, chromosome condensation and anaphase entry
Download2012
Campbell, S.D., Homola, E.M., Fasulo, B., Yu, K.R., Hsieh, T.S., Sullivan, W., Koyama, C.
Defects in DNA replication and chromosome condensation are common phenotypes in cancer cells. A link between replication and condensation has been established, but little is known about the role of checkpoints in monitoring chromosome condensation. We investigate this function by live analysis,...

Goldfish ghrelin: Molecular characterization of the complementary deoxyribonucleic acid, partial gene structure and evidence for its stimulatory role in food intake
Download2002
Rivier, J., Kaiya, H., Lin, X.W., Cervini, L., Unniappan, S., Peter, R.E., Kangawa, K.
Complementary deoxyribonucleic acid (cDNA) encoding goldfish preproghrelin was identified using rapid amplification of the cDNA ends (RACE) and reverse transcription (RT)-polymerase chain reaction (PCR). The 490 bp cDNA encodes a 103 amino acid preproghrelin which has a 26 amino acid signal...
